Action
REAP
puts its research knowledge into action by engaging policy-makers on key
food system issues, advocating for sustainable food groups, and
organizing outreach events like the annual Food For Thought Festival. We
learn from and support the activities of a myriad of progressive,
sustainability-oriented groups that make
up our area's sustainable food movement.
Our
current action projects
include:
Food For Thought Festival - An annual fall festival held in
conjunction with the Dane County Farmers' Market.
Farm Fresh Atlas - A guide
to fresh produce, meat, cheese, and other locally grown food.
Wisconsin Homegrown Lunch - An effort to bring locally grown food
into the Madison Metropolitan School District's lunchrooms. |
From
working to save family farms to investigating low
levels of university funding for
sustainable agriculture to initiating the development of a farmers'
market for Madison's south side neighborhood, REAP
fosters an activated citizenry that takes an interest in its food
system.
